AGRICULTURE NEWS - Equine athletes, like human athletes, put a great deal of strain on their ligaments and joints when competing, especially at a high level.
Adequate rest and systematic training and riding are a very important part of maintaining joint health.
The main precaution that should be taken by owners and trainers is never to administer intra-articular injections yourself! Only qualified equine veterinarians have the knowledge and experience to do them successfully. Moreover, prescription drugs are mostly used for these kinds of injections.
